THE HOUSE of Representative on Tuesday approved on second reading three priority tax measures, which seek to remove the tax exemption on pickup trucks and impose taxes on foreign digital services and single-use plastic bags. READ
“The measures could yield a total of P47 billion annually,” Albay Rep. Jose Ma. Clemente S. Salceda, who chairs the House Ways and Means Committee, said in a statement.
HB 4339 proposes to rationalize the documentary stamp tax regime by imposing a single rate on the original issue of shares and units of participation of collective investment schemes. It also seeks to remove the DST on documents required for routine transactions. This would also amend the National Internal Revenue Code of 1997 to include a section that would require foreign digital service providers to collect and remit VAT for all transactions that are done through their platforms.
